Typical Dental Braces: How They Function
When considering orthodontic treatments for dental imbalances, conventional dental braces stand out as a time-tested approach for fixing teeth positioning. Typical braces are composed of brackets, cables, and bands that function with each other to apply continual pressure on the teeth, progressively moving them into the preferred positioning.
One key aspect of how standard braces work is the procedure of bone improvement. As pressure is applied to the teeth through the dental braces, the bone bordering the teeth is reshaped to sustain the new tooth settings. This improvement is necessary for the long-term stability of the remedied positioning. Clients will require normal modifications at the orthodontist's workplace to ensure the dental braces remain to apply the right pressure for effective teeth activity.

Surgical Orthodontic Options
Surgical treatments in orthodontics present feasible options for addressing intricate dental imbalances that may not be effectively settled with traditional orthodontic therapies. While conventional dental braces and undetectable aligners can fix lots of orthodontic problems, particular situations call for medical intervention to attain optimum outcomes. Surgical orthodontic choices are usually recommended for serious malocclusions, significant jaw disparities, and cases where the underlying bone framework needs modification to accomplish appropriate placement.
One usual surgical orthodontic treatment is orthognathic their explanation surgical treatment, which involves repositioning the jaws to deal with useful issues such as difficulty chewing or talking. This surgical procedure is commonly performed in cooperation with an orthodontist who assists align the teeth before and after the treatment. Surgical orthodontics may additionally involve procedures to expose influenced teeth, get rid of excess gum cells, or reshape the jawbone to produce a more unified facial account.
Prior to thinking about medical orthodontic options, individuals undertake a comprehensive evaluation to identify the need and potential benefits of such treatments. orthodontist. While surgical treatment might seem daunting, it can dramatically boost both the feature and looks of the smile in cases where traditional orthodontic therapies fail
